Core Drilling: An Overview
When considering core drilling, it’s essential to understand its purpose and benefits. Core drilling is a technique used to create precise, circular holes in tough materials like concrete, stone, or masonry. It is commonly employed in construction, renovation, and DIY projects where clean and accurate cuts are necessary.
Understanding Core Drilling
Core drilling involves removing a cylinder-shaped portion of material from the surface, leaving behind a clean and precise hole. This process is favored for its efficiency and accuracy, making it ideal for tasks that require professional results.
Hammer Drill vs. Core Drilling
While a hammer drill is a versatile tool that can tackle various drilling tasks, including those requiring extra power for tough surfaces, it is not typically used for core drilling. Core drilling machines are specifically designed for this purpose, offering specialized features that ensure clean cuts without the need for a hammering action.
Machinery for Core Drilling
To perform core drilling effectively, you need a core drill machine equipped with a core bit suitable for the material you’re working on. These machines are designed to provide the necessary power and stability required for creating consistent and precise holes.

Can You Use a Hammer Drill for Core Drilling?
When it comes to core drilling, you might wonder if you can utilize your trusty hammer drill for the job. While a hammer drill is a versatile tool, it’s essential to understand its limitations in the context of core drilling.
While a hammer drill can be used for small projects, it’s not the optimal tool for core drilling into tough surfaces like concrete or masonry. The primary function of a hammer drill is to create holes in materials by combining rotary drilling with a forward hammering action. This mechanism is useful for tasks such as drilling into bricks or light concrete, where the hammering helps break up the material.
However, for core drilling, where precision and clean cuts are crucial, a dedicated core drilling machine is recommended. Core drills are specifically designed to remove cylinders of material and create smooth, accurate holes without the hammering action present in a standard hammer drill.
Using a hammer drill for core drilling on tougher surfaces can lead to inaccuracies, rough edges, and an overall lack of precision. In contrast, a core drilling machine with the appropriate bit ensures cleaner cuts and professional results, especially in projects that demand accuracy and finesse.
